Output 6c890922b13bf82ff59a54295815d856c30788aece67a582aa73dc9c6f2d7952:3

value
120567694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ad0d30efcb7218a34d043a36ff5e0650b13612 OP_EQUAL
address
MBRfDYtoccXhbtERuyXTWMsRbqNejk4pYu
transaction
6c890922b13bf82ff59a54295815d856c30788aece67a582aa73dc9c6f2d7952
spent
true